Every year the ocean takes a little more of Harbor—until it comes for the people. When a corpse washes into a living room on the last livable street, paramedic Wren Keene knows it isn't a storm surge. The tides aren't obeying the moon. Mail slots clack with letters no one sent. Bathtubs fill from the sea. And in the fog, a man with a ring of keys walks the routes like a ferryman taking attendance. With a perigean storm closing in, Wren pulls together an unlikely crew: Lina , a teenage field recorder who hears patterns in the hum; Jonah , a stubborn waterman with a bad knee; Mrs. Dorrit , keeper of the town's minutes and its dead letters; Dr. Corin Vale , whose "smart" drainage model may have taught the water to hunt; and Eli , Wren's father, whose lucid hours arrive like low tide. Their only chance is to unteach the town—strip the numbers, misfile the names, and raise a drowned ship's bell that can make the cut forget its appetite. But the ledger under Harbor keeps three columns—paper, code, and mouth—and it wants a final entry. As the highest tide of the year lifts, Wren must decide what to surrender: her deed, her name, or someone she can't afford to lose. A coastal gothic thriller about routes, debts, and a town that refuses to be counted.
